Essential Experience Highlights for a Strong Coil Tier Resume

To significantly enhance the impact of your Coil Tier resume, carefully consider incorporating the following key responsibilities and achievements into your experience section.
  • Operate coil handling equipment, including overhead cranes, forklifts, and pallet jacks, to load, unload, and transport coils of steel.
  • Inspect coils for damage and ensure they are properly stored and inventoried.
  • Maintain a clean and organized work area, and adhere to all safety protocols.
  • Train and mentor new coil tiers, ensuring they are proficient in coil handling procedures.
  • Collaborate with maintenance team to resolve issues with coil handling equipment.
  • Develop and implement innovative coil handling techniques to improve efficiency and reduce downtime.
  • Stay abreast of industry best practices and advancements in coil handling technology.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Coil Tier

  • What is the job outlook for Coil Tiers?

    The job outlook for Coil Tiers is expected to be good over the next few years. The steel industry is growing, and as a result, there will be a need for more Coil Tiers to handle the increased production of steel.

  • What are the qualifications for becoming a Coil Tier?

    Most Coil Tiers have a high school diploma or equivalent. Some employers may require Coil Tiers to have a commercial driver’s license (CDL).

  • What is the average salary for a Coil Tier?

    The average salary for a Coil Tier is around $35,000 per year.

  • What are the benefits of working as a Coil Tier?

    Some of the benefits of working as a Coil Tier include: competitive pay, good benefits, and the opportunity to work in a fast-paced environment.

  • What are the challenges of working as a Coil Tier?

    Some of the challenges of working as a Coil Tier include: working in a physically demanding environment, working long hours, and working in a potentially hazardous environment.

  • What are the career opportunities for Coil Tiers?

    Coil Tiers can advance to positions such as Coil Handler, Crane Operator, or Supervisor.
